Distance From Boguchany Airport to New Chitose Airport

The distance from Boguchany Airport () to New Chitose Airport (CTS) is 2166 miles or 3485 kilometers or 1881 nautical miles.

How long does it take to travel from Boguchany ( Russia ) to Sapporo ( Japan )?

A one-way nonstop (direct) flight between Boguchany and Sapporo takes around 4 hours 58 minutes.
Estimated flight time from Boguchany Airport, Boguchany, Russia to New Chitose Airport, Sapporo, Japan is 4 hours 58 minutes under avarage conditions.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ind direction/speed or weather conditions. This calculation does not include the departure and landing times of the aircraft.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ight?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
